Cheese Omelet Nutrition Facts: Calories, Macros & Health Benefits

Summary: One serving (130g) of cheese omelet contains 252 calories, 16.4g protein, 1.9g carbs, and 20.0g fat. Cheese Omelet is a good source of saturated fat, cholesterol, sodium.

NutrientAmount% Daily Value
Calories252 kcal13%
Protein16.4g33%
Carbohydrates1.9g1%
Total Fat20.0g26%
Sugar0.65g--
Saturated Fat7.0g35%
Cholesterol451.1mg150%
Sodium473.2mg21%
Potassium166.4mg4%
Calcium196.3mg15%
Iron1.9mg10%
Magnesium16.9mg4%
Zinc1.8mg16%
Vitamin A295.1mcg33%
Vitamin B60.28mg16%
Vitamin B121.1mcg46%
Folate58.5mcg15%
Vitamin K8.1mcg7%
Phosphorus288.6mg23%

Is Cheese Omelet Good for You?

Cheese Omelet provides 252 calories per serving (130g) with 16.4g of protein, 1.9g of carbohydrates, and 20.0g of fat. It is a source of saturated fat (35% dv), cholesterol (150% dv), sodium (21% dv).
